Rajini is derived from the Sanskrit word 'rajan' meaning king or ruler. Historically, it has been used in Indian culture to signify leadership, authority, and nobility. The name embodies qualities of strength and sovereignty, often associated with royal lineage or someone who leads with dignity and grace.

Cultural Significance of Rajini

In Indian culture, the name Rajini is revered due to its royal connotations, symbolizing leadership and power. It has been popularized by iconic figures in Indian cinema and literature, often linked with qualities of heroism and charisma. The name carries a legacy of respect and influence, especially in South India, where it also relates to historical rulers and cultural icons.

Rajini Thiranagama

Sri Lankan human rights activist and academic known for her advocacy during the Sri Lankan civil conflict.

Rajini Krishnan

Prominent Indian motorcycle racer with multiple national championships.
